P-shape conservatories
If you are considering renovating your home, then you might want to consider adding a gable end conservatory. These conservatories can expand the size of your house and offer more space for various purposes. There are many styles to choose from: P-shaped Victorian, Edwardian and L-shaped. Each style comes with distinctive features that make them suitable for a variety of homes.
The Victorian conservatory is a popular style of conservatory particularly in Greater Manchester. This conservatory is a traditional style with a sloping roof. Its clean lines, combined with its traditional look, make it perfect for almost any home.
A P-shaped conservatory is a mix of the Victorian conservatory and a lean to. It is possible to get this kind of conservatory in a variety of sizes and shapes, allowing you to create a cozy living room or an open office.
Another option is a conservatory with a lantern roof. Similar to an orangery, these structures have an open-air glass lantern that lets natural light to fill the space. Lantern roofs are also great for period homes. They can be used to provide an extra light source to your home.
When you're looking to select a conservatory, you'll want to look for one that's energy efficient, quiet and also offers thermal insulation. A PVCU conservatory is a great option, since it comes with a 10 year guarantee.
